P2666 [USACO07OCT] Bessie's Secret Pasture S
Description
Farmer John recently harvested an almost infinite number of sod patches and stacked them in an open area. These patches are all squares with nonnegative integer side lengths (including $0$). One day his cow Bessie discovered these delicious sod patches and wants to plant them in her secret pasture. She divides the sod into $1\times1$ unit pieces to place them into the $N$ cells of her pasture.
Bessie is interested in how many different ways there are if she chooses four patches. If $N=4$, then she has $5$ different ways: (1,1,1,1), (2,0,0,0), (0,2,0,0), (0,0,2,0), (0,0,0,2); the numbers in parentheses denote side lengths. Note that order matters; for example, (1,2,3,4) and (4,3,2,1) are two different ways.
Input Format
A single line with one integer $N$.
Output Format
A single line containing one integer: the total number of ways.
Explanation/Hint
Constraints: For 100% of the testdata, $1\le N\le10000$.
